On-Chain Analysis Reveals: Bitcoin Whales Driving Current Price Increase

Bitcoin's recent price surge has sparked intense debate within the crypto community. While various factors are often cited, a compelling narrative is emerging from on-chain analysis: Bitcoin whales are the primary force behind this upward momentum. This isn't just speculation; deep dives into blockchain data reveal a clear pattern of large-scale accumulation and strategic trading activity by these high-net-worth investors.

This article delves into the key findings of recent on-chain analyses, explaining how whale activity is influencing Bitcoin's price and what it might mean for the future of the cryptocurrency market.

The Whale Effect: Accumulation and Price Manipulation?

The term "whale" in the crypto world refers to individuals or entities holding a significant amount of Bitcoin, often exceeding 1,000 BTC. These whales wield considerable market power, and their actions can significantly impact price fluctuations. Recent on-chain data strongly suggests a period of significant accumulation by these whales.

Several key metrics support this conclusion:

  • Increased Accumulation Addresses: Analysis shows a notable increase in the number of addresses holding substantial amounts of Bitcoin. This suggests whales are actively buying and holding, potentially anticipating further price appreciation.
  • Decreased Exchange Outflows: Data reveals a reduction in the flow of Bitcoin from exchanges to external wallets. This indicates whales are less inclined to sell, further supporting the theory of accumulation.
  • Large Transaction Volumes: The observation of numerous large transactions (often exceeding 1,000 BTC) hints at strategic trading activity by whales, likely influencing market sentiment and price.

This isn't necessarily nefarious price manipulation. Whales may simply be taking advantage of perceived market undervaluation, accumulating Bitcoin in anticipation of future growth. However, the sheer scale of their activity undeniably impacts price dynamics.

Implications for Bitcoin's Future

The implications of this whale-driven price increase are complex and multifaceted:

  • Short-Term Volatility: While whale accumulation can drive prices upward, it can also lead to increased short-term volatility. Sudden shifts in whale trading strategies could cause sharp price corrections.
  • Long-Term Growth Potential: If whales maintain their accumulation strategy, it could indicate a strong belief in Bitcoin's long-term potential, potentially fueling sustained price growth.
  • Market Sentiment: Whale activity significantly impacts overall market sentiment. Large buys can be perceived as a bullish signal, encouraging other investors to enter the market.

Beyond the Whales: Other Contributing Factors

It's crucial to remember that while whale activity plays a significant role, it's not the only factor influencing Bitcoin's price. Other contributing elements include:

  • Macroeconomic factors: Global economic uncertainty and inflation can influence investor appetite for Bitcoin as a safe haven asset.
  • Regulatory developments: Changes in regulatory landscapes globally can impact Bitcoin's adoption and price.
  • Technological advancements: Developments within the Bitcoin network, such as the Lightning Network, can improve its scalability and usability, further driving adoption.
